Take Note Theatre Announces SHERLOCK HOLMES AND THE INVISIBLE THING At Rudolf Steiner Theatre


Take Note Theatre today, on Arthur Conan Doyle's birthday, announces the brand-new production of Sherlock Holmes and The Invisible Thing, to be staged at Rudolf Steiner Theatre - a stone's throw from Holmes' 221B Baker Street. Written by Greg Freeman and directed by David Phipps-Davis, the production opens on 25 July, with previews from 17 July, and runs until 18 August.

World Premiere of SOVIET ZION to Debut in London this Autumn


The new musical drama Soviet Zion will make its debut in London this October. It tells the story of an American family and a Ukrainian family who in 1939 both move to Siberia participating in a movement to create there a socialist Yiddish-speaking utopia. The reality they face is not what they had been led to believe, and great personal sacrifice will have to be made in order for them to achieve the freedom they seek.
